27 #include <MemoryX/interface/core/EntityBase.h>
28 #include <MemoryX/interface/memorytypes/MemoryEntities.h>
29 #include <MemoryX/interface/memorytypes/MemorySegments.h>
40 virtual public WorldStateSegmentBase
50 getWorldInstanceById(const ::std::string&
id,
51 const ::Ice::Current& = Ice::emptyCurrent)
const override;
57 getWorldInstanceByName(const ::std::string& name,
58 const ::Ice::Current& = Ice::emptyCurrent)
const override;
64 getWorldInstancesByClass(const ::std::string& className,
65 const ::Ice::Current&
c = Ice::emptyCurrent)
const override;
71 getWorldInstancesByClassList(
const NameList& classList,
72 const ::Ice::Current& = Ice::emptyCurrent)
const override;